|
Implementace diskusní skupiny pro studenty
Šebek, Michal ; Techet, Jiří (oponent) ; Lukáš, Roman (vedoucí práce)
Tato práce se zabývá analýzou a vývojem informačního systému - diskusní skupiny určené pro používání studenty technické školy. Práce je zaměřena především na shrnutí poznatků při implementaci speciálních funkcí jakožto dynamického vkládání obrázků, tabulek a vzorců ve formátu systému LaTeX do komentářů. Rovněž diskutuje možnost použití umělé inteligence jako nástroje pro vyhledávání vulgarizmů v textu komentářů. Implementace systému proběhla s použitím jazyků PHP, MySQL, XHTML, CSS a Javascript.
|
|
Dynamický definovatelný dashboard
Počatko, Boris ; Burget, Radek (oponent) ; Šebek, Michal (vedoucí práce)
Tato diplomová práce pojednává o návrhu a implementaci dynamicky definovatelného dashboardu. Uživatel si bude moci definovat podmínky, které budou filtrovat a zaznamenávat pouze informace pro něj důležité. Zároveň bude aplikace podporovat změnu podmínek a vzhledu jednotlivých grafů za běhu systému. Nastudované implementace, které jsou dostupné na webu, jsou určené jen pro jeden účel a nejsou navrhnuté tak, aby respektovaly všeobecně platné postupy pro tvorbu dashboardu. Dashboard řešený v rámci diplomové práce je navržen tak, aby zvládal databáze s vysokou zátěží a nezpomaloval chod celé aplikace.
|
|
Rozšíření funkcionality systému pro dolování z dat na platformě NetBeans
Šebek, Michal ; Zendulka, Jaroslav (oponent) ; Lukáš, Roman (vedoucí práce)
Databáze se neustále rozrůstají o nová data. Za účelem analýzy těchto dat byl definován proces získávání znalostí z databází. Pro podporu tohoto procesu vznikla řada nástrojů. Vývojem jednoho z těchto nástrojů se zabývá tato práce. Hlavním cílem je analyzovat stávající implementaci systému na přenositelné platformě Java NetBeans a databázovém serveru Oracle a rozšířit ji o algoritmy z oblasti předzpracování a analýzy vstupních dat. Podrobně je popsána implementace jednotlivých komponent pro předzpracování dat a provedené změny v jádře systému.
|
|
Nástroj pro vyhodnocování optimalizace webových stránek
Hák, Karel ; Šebek, Michal (oponent) ; Burget, Radek (vedoucí práce)
Práce se zabývá principy webových vyhledávačů, způsoby, jakými lze webové stránky optimalizovat pro vyhledávače a návrhem nástroje, který bude na základě zvolených parametrů (klíčová slova, pozice ve vyhledávačích, ohodnocení stránky - SRank a PageRank) vyhodnocovat míru optimalizace konkrétní webové stránky. Dále je v práci rozebrána implementace navrženého nástroje, použité techonologe (PHP, XML-RPC, CSS, JavaScript) a knihovny (Nette framework).
|
| |
|
Využití víceúrovňových asociačních pravidel v internetovém obchodu
Králík, Michael ; Šebek, Michal (oponent) ; Bartík, Vladimír (vedoucí práce)
Tato bakalářská práce se zabývá návrhem a implementací kompletního informačního systému pro potřeby elektronického obchodu, v jehož prostředí bude využito víceúrovňových asociačních pravidel pro dolování dat. Informační systém bude dále obsahovat vedení skladu, automatické zpracování objednávek, vedení plateb, daňovou evidenci a zobrazování různých statistik. K implementaci tohoto systému byly použity technologie HTML, Latte, CSS, JavaScript, Nette Framework, PHP a MySQL.
|
|
Dolování periodických vzorů
Stríž, Rostislav ; Zendulka, Jaroslav (oponent) ; Šebek, Michal (vedoucí práce)
Sběr a analýza dat jsou dnes běžnou praxí v mnoha odvětvích vědy i podnikání. Proces \emph{získávání znalostí z databází} umožňuje získat z uložených dat nové a zajímavé informace, které lze využít k dalšímu rozvoji. Tato práce popisuje základní principy takovéhoto procesu se zaměřením na získávání znalostí z temporálních dat, konkrétně na dolování periodických vzorů v časových řadách. V rámci projektu byly implementovány vybrané algoritmy pro dolování periodických vzorů ve formě dolovacích plug-inů pro službu Microsoft Analysis Services, která zajišťuje rozhraní pro dolování z dat nad platformou Microsoft SQL Server. Dokument popisuje detaily této implementace a diskutuje výsledky provedených experimentů, které se zaměřují zejména na časovou náročnost jednotlivých algoritmů.
|
|
Klasifikační dolovací moduly systému pro dolování z dat na platformě NetBeans
Kuzma, Norbert ; Šuška, Boris (oponent) ; Šebek, Michal (vedoucí práce)
Tato bakalářská práce se zabývá dolováním z dat a vytvořením dolovacího modulu pro systém pro dolování z dat, který je vyvíjen na FIT. Jedná se o klientskou aplikaci skládající se z jádra a jeho grafického uživatelského rozhraní a nezávislých dolovacích modulů. Aplikace je implementována v jazyce Java a její grafické uživatelské rozhraní je postaveno na platformě NetBeans. Obsahem této práce bude uvedení do problematiky získávání znalostí z databází a následně seznámení s neuronovými síťemi, pro které bude následně implementován samotný dolovací modul. Dále bude popsána implementace tohoto modulu.
|
|
Agentní systém pro vyhledávání na realitních serverech
Šimara, Michal ; Šebek, Michal (oponent) ; Filák, Jakub (vedoucí práce)
Cílem této bakalářské práce je návrhnout a implementovat agentní systém pro vyhledávání na realitních serverech. Agentní systémy jsou v dnešní době jedním z populárních témat v oblasti umělé inteligence a nabízí velkou řadu možných využití. Jedním z nich je například vyhledávání informací v prostředí webu. V této práci jsou popsány některé existující vyhledávací systémy založené na agentním přístupu. Ty sloužily jako inspirace při navrhu výsledného systému, který se snaží vyhledat informace na realitních serverech a poskytnout jejich přehled.
|
| |